Maximizing Efficiency in Pipe Welding: The Role of CR-500T Conventional Welding Roller and Industry Insights

In the realm of pipe welding, efficiency is paramount, and the CR-500T Conventional Welding Roller stands out as a crucial player in enhancing productivity. Designed to handle a turning capacity of up to 500 tons, this welding roller is a robust solution for various pipe sizes and weights. Its dual adjustable load capacities of 250 tons each for both drive and idler ensure that operators can maintain a consistent and stable rotational movement, critical for achieving high-quality welds.

The CR-500 model features a bolt adjustment mechanism, allowing quick and precise setup, minimizing downtime during welding operations. Coupled with a powerful dual motor system that delivers a combined 15 kW, the roller not only supports heavy loads but also enhances the overall efficiency of the welding process. This efficiency is vital in industries where time and precision are closely linked to profitability, making the CR-500 indispensable for modern welding setups.
